Do you have the Case & car-cable/socket of the Podpoint? If you're trying to ressurect a broken Podpoint, you have the option of ditching the PCB + relays on it, and install a Viridian Controller, commercial Contactor and maybe an RCBO/whatever safety bits are needed. There's a guy here in UK who repairs broken Podpoints this way, and I upgraded my Rolec using a Viridian Controller, same end result.
